Falcon Lodge sits in the Morel residential district of central Méribel, a position that balances slope access with village convenience. The Morel chairlift, 200 metres away on foot, opens up the Altiport beginner area and the Forêt green run down to Rond Point, from where the wider Three Valleys network becomes accessible. The building's ski-in/ski-out access means the return journey ends at your door via the blue Hulotte piste. For the main lift hub at La Chaudanne — home to the Rhodos and Saulire gondolas and the principal ski school meeting points — the residence operates a driver shuttle service covering the journey in around five minutes. The village centre, with its concentration of restaurants, bars, and shops, is a ten-minute downhill walk or a short ride on the regular village bus that stops nearby.

Méribel sits at the geographic center of the world-renowned Les Trois Vallées, offering seamless access to the largest interconnected ski area on the planet. Unlike many purpose-built French resorts, Méribel retains a traditional Savoyard charm, strictly adhering to chalet-style architecture with distinctive wood and stone facades that blend beautifully into the wooded surroundings. The resort is divided into several neighborhoods, primarily Méribel Centre, Méribel-Mottaret, and Méribel Village, each offering a slightly different vibe. Mottaret provides prime ski-in/ski-out access and higher altitude, while Méribel Centre boasts a lively atmosphere, sophisticated boutiques, and legendary après-ski venues. Skiers and snowboarders flock to Méribel for its incredibly diverse terrain. Its central position makes it the perfect launchpad for exploring Courchevel to the east and Val Thorens to the west, while offering its own pristine local slopes, immaculate snowparks, and spectacular high-alpine descents from Mont Vallon.
Méribel's local valley features 150km of pristine pistes, seamlessly linking into the 600km of the Three Valleys. The terrain caters perfectly to everyone, offering sheltered, tree-lined beginner zones at the Altiport, vast rolling red runs for intermediates, and challenging steep descents and off-piste bowls from the Mont Vallon peak.

Widespread shared and private shuttle services are available from Geneva, Lyon, and Chambery airports. Several paid underground car parks are located in Méribel Centre and Mottaret; advance booking is highly recommended.
Early December to late April
The Three Valleys pass is highly recommended over the local Méribel Valley pass to maximize the experience.
